Big underworld fan here too. Do you guys all know about Bootleg Babies? A fan made live comp that was a response to Everything, Everything missing out so may good tracks/versions. Sound quality is brilliant, think they spent quite a bit of time mastering it all and segueing the tracks together, the 17 min version of Rez/Cowgirl is superb. There were only 150 CD copies made but the mp3 version was pretty easy to track down, PM me if you can't find it.

Underworld would definitely be in my top five bands. Other than Barking, on which I only like a few tracks (most of them from the bonus disc), I fucking love all of their albums. Everything from the bizarre abstract messy artwork, to their totally idiosyncratic titles (Nuxx, Telematic, Oich Oich, Tin There, Spoonman, Glam Bucket, If Rah, Jumping the Cran), Hyde's wonderfully unusual lyrics, his incredible range of vocal styles, Rick Smith's totally gorgeous unmistakable production, their consistently brilliant line in ambient and downtempo tracks that takes up half of their catalogue, and the superb storming bangers that they're best known for. Barely a bad song in there, and just an entirely unique world that's formed from their completely individual take on music, words and visuals. Incredible band.
